www.businessmad.com - Business Media and Data Limited
Showing 1 - 2 of 2 Results

Windscreen Glass New & Replacement Services Results - Manchester


Autoglaze
Manchester, England, M9 7EW, United Kingdom

Windscreens Online
Manchester, England, M38 0BN, United Kingdom